248c2ecf20Sopenharmony_ci/**
258c2ecf20Sopenharmony_ci * struct spear_pmx_mode - SPEAr pmx mode
268c2ecf20Sopenharmony_ci * @name: name of pmx mode
278c2ecf20Sopenharmony_ci * @mode: mode id
288c2ecf20Sopenharmony_ci * @reg: register for configuring this mode
298c2ecf20Sopenharmony_ci * @mask: mask of this mode in reg
308c2ecf20Sopenharmony_ci * @val: val to be configured at reg after doing (val & mask)
318c2ecf20Sopenharmony_ci */
328c2ecf20Sopenharmony_cistruct spear_pmx_mode {
338c2ecf20Sopenharmony_ci	const char *const name;
348c2ecf20Sopenharmony_ci	u16 mode;
358c2ecf20Sopenharmony_ci	u16 reg;
368c2ecf20Sopenharmony_ci	u16 mask;
378c2ecf20Sopenharmony_ci	u32 val;
388c2ecf20Sopenharmony_ci};
398c2ecf20Sopenharmony_ci
408c2ecf20Sopenharmony_ci/**
418c2ecf20Sopenharmony_ci * struct spear_muxreg - SPEAr mux reg configuration
428c2ecf20Sopenharmony_ci * @reg: register offset
438c2ecf20Sopenharmony_ci * @mask: mask bits
448c2ecf20Sopenharmony_ci * @val: val to be written on mask bits
458c2ecf20Sopenharmony_ci */
468c2ecf20Sopenharmony_cistruct spear_muxreg {
478c2ecf20Sopenharmony_ci	u16 reg;
488c2ecf20Sopenharmony_ci	u32 mask;
498c2ecf20Sopenharmony_ci	u32 val;
508c2ecf20Sopenharmony_ci};
518c2ecf20Sopenharmony_ci
528c2ecf20Sopenharmony_cistruct spear_gpio_pingroup {
538c2ecf20Sopenharmony_ci	const unsigned *pins;
548c2ecf20Sopenharmony_ci	unsigned npins;
558c2ecf20Sopenharmony_ci	struct spear_muxreg *muxregs;
568c2ecf20Sopenharmony_ci	u8 nmuxregs;
578c2ecf20Sopenharmony_ci};
588c2ecf20Sopenharmony_ci
598c2ecf20Sopenharmony_ci/* ste: set to enable */
608c2ecf20Sopenharmony_ci#define DEFINE_MUXREG(__pins, __muxreg, __mask, __ste)		\
618c2ecf20Sopenharmony_cistatic struct spear_muxreg __pins##_muxregs[] = {		\
628c2ecf20Sopenharmony_ci	{							\
638c2ecf20Sopenharmony_ci		.reg = __muxreg,				\
648c2ecf20Sopenharmony_ci		.mask = __mask,					\
658c2ecf20Sopenharmony_ci		.val = __ste ? __mask : 0,			\
668c2ecf20Sopenharmony_ci	},							\
678c2ecf20Sopenharmony_ci}
688c2ecf20Sopenharmony_ci
698c2ecf20Sopenharmony_ci#define DEFINE_2_MUXREG(__pins, __muxreg1, __muxreg2, __mask, __ste1, __ste2) \
708c2ecf20Sopenharmony_cistatic struct spear_muxreg __pins##_muxregs[] = {		\
718c2ecf20Sopenharmony_ci	{							\
728c2ecf20Sopenharmony_ci		.reg = __muxreg1,				\
738c2ecf20Sopenharmony_ci		.mask = __mask,					\
748c2ecf20Sopenharmony_ci		.val = __ste1 ? __mask : 0,			\
758c2ecf20Sopenharmony_ci	}, {							\
768c2ecf20Sopenharmony_ci		.reg = __muxreg2,				\
778c2ecf20Sopenharmony_ci		.mask = __mask,					\
788c2ecf20Sopenharmony_ci		.val = __ste2 ? __mask : 0,			\
798c2ecf20Sopenharmony_ci	},							\
808c2ecf20Sopenharmony_ci}
818c2ecf20Sopenharmony_ci
828c2ecf20Sopenharmony_ci#define GPIO_PINGROUP(__pins)					\
838c2ecf20Sopenharmony_ci	{							\
848c2ecf20Sopenharmony_ci		.pins = __pins,					\
858c2ecf20Sopenharmony_ci		.npins = ARRAY_SIZE(__pins),			\
868c2ecf20Sopenharmony_ci		.muxregs = __pins##_muxregs,			\
878c2ecf20Sopenharmony_ci		.nmuxregs = ARRAY_SIZE(__pins##_muxregs),	\
888c2ecf20Sopenharmony_ci	}
898c2ecf20Sopenharmony_ci
908c2ecf20Sopenharmony_ci/**
918c2ecf20Sopenharmony_ci * struct spear_modemux - SPEAr mode mux configuration
928c2ecf20Sopenharmony_ci * @modes: mode ids supported by this group of muxregs
938c2ecf20Sopenharmony_ci * @nmuxregs: number of muxreg configurations to be done for modes
948c2ecf20Sopenharmony_ci * @muxregs: array of muxreg configurations to be done for modes
958c2ecf20Sopenharmony_ci */
968c2ecf20Sopenharmony_cistruct spear_modemux {
978c2ecf20Sopenharmony_ci	u16 modes;
988c2ecf20Sopenharmony_ci	u8 nmuxregs;
998c2ecf20Sopenharmony_ci	struct spear_muxreg *muxregs;
1008c2ecf20Sopenharmony_ci};
1018c2ecf20Sopenharmony_ci
1028c2ecf20Sopenharmony_ci/**
1038c2ecf20Sopenharmony_ci * struct spear_pingroup - SPEAr pin group configurations
1048c2ecf20Sopenharmony_ci * @name: name of pin group
1058c2ecf20Sopenharmony_ci * @pins: array containing pin numbers
1068c2ecf20Sopenharmony_ci * @npins: size of pins array
1078c2ecf20Sopenharmony_ci * @modemuxs: array of modemux configurations for this pin group
1088c2ecf20Sopenharmony_ci * @nmodemuxs: size of array modemuxs
1098c2ecf20Sopenharmony_ci *
1108c2ecf20Sopenharmony_ci * A representation of a group of pins in the SPEAr pin controller. Each group
1118c2ecf20Sopenharmony_ci * allows some parameter or parameters to be configured.
1128c2ecf20Sopenharmony_ci */
1138c2ecf20Sopenharmony_cistruct spear_pingroup {
1148c2ecf20Sopenharmony_ci	const char *name;
1158c2ecf20Sopenharmony_ci	const unsigned *pins;
1168c2ecf20Sopenharmony_ci	unsigned npins;
1178c2ecf20Sopenharmony_ci	struct spear_modemux *modemuxs;
1188c2ecf20Sopenharmony_ci	unsigned nmodemuxs;
1198c2ecf20Sopenharmony_ci};
1208c2ecf20Sopenharmony_ci
1218c2ecf20Sopenharmony_ci/**
1228c2ecf20Sopenharmony_ci * struct spear_function - SPEAr pinctrl mux function
1238c2ecf20Sopenharmony_ci * @name: The name of the function, exported to pinctrl core.
1248c2ecf20Sopenharmony_ci * @groups: An array of pin groups that may select this function.
1258c2ecf20Sopenharmony_ci * @ngroups: The number of entries in @groups.
1268c2ecf20Sopenharmony_ci */
1278c2ecf20Sopenharmony_cistruct spear_function {
1288c2ecf20Sopenharmony_ci	const char *name;
1298c2ecf20Sopenharmony_ci	const char *const *groups;
1308c2ecf20Sopenharmony_ci	unsigned ngroups;
1318c2ecf20Sopenharmony_ci};
1328c2ecf20Sopenharmony_ci
1338c2ecf20Sopenharmony_ci/**
1348c2ecf20Sopenharmony_ci * struct spear_pinctrl_machdata - SPEAr pin controller machine driver
1358c2ecf20Sopenharmony_ci *	configuration
1368c2ecf20Sopenharmony_ci * @pins: An array describing all pins the pin controller affects.
1378c2ecf20Sopenharmony_ci *	All pins which are also GPIOs must be listed first within the *array,
1388c2ecf20Sopenharmony_ci *	and be numbered identically to the GPIO controller's *numbering.
1398c2ecf20Sopenharmony_ci * @npins: The numbmer of entries in @pins.
1408c2ecf20Sopenharmony_ci * @functions: An array describing all mux functions the SoC supports.
1418c2ecf20Sopenharmony_ci * @nfunctions: The numbmer of entries in @functions.
1428c2ecf20Sopenharmony_ci * @groups: An array describing all pin groups the pin SoC supports.
1438c2ecf20Sopenharmony_ci * @ngroups: The numbmer of entries in @groups.
1448c2ecf20Sopenharmony_ci * @gpio_pingroups: gpio pingroups
1458c2ecf20Sopenharmony_ci * @ngpio_pingroups: gpio pingroups count
1468c2ecf20Sopenharmony_ci *
1478c2ecf20Sopenharmony_ci * @modes_supported: Does SoC support modes
1488c2ecf20Sopenharmony_ci * @mode: mode configured from probe
1498c2ecf20Sopenharmony_ci * @pmx_modes: array of modes supported by SoC
1508c2ecf20Sopenharmony_ci * @npmx_modes: number of entries in pmx_modes.
1518c2ecf20Sopenharmony_ci */
1528c2ecf20Sopenharmony_cistruct spear_pinctrl_machdata {
1538c2ecf20Sopenharmony_ci	const struct pinctrl_pin_desc *pins;
1548c2ecf20Sopenharmony_ci	unsigned npins;
1558c2ecf20Sopenharmony_ci	struct spear_function **functions;
1568c2ecf20Sopenharmony_ci	unsigned nfunctions;
1578c2ecf20Sopenharmony_ci	struct spear_pingroup **groups;
1588c2ecf20Sopenharmony_ci	unsigned ngroups;
1598c2ecf20Sopenharmony_ci	struct spear_gpio_pingroup *gpio_pingroups;
1608c2ecf20Sopenharmony_ci	void (*gpio_request_endisable)(struct spear_pmx *pmx, int offset,
1618c2ecf20Sopenharmony_ci			bool enable);
1628c2ecf20Sopenharmony_ci	unsigned ngpio_pingroups;
1638c2ecf20Sopenharmony_ci
1648c2ecf20Sopenharmony_ci	bool modes_supported;
1658c2ecf20Sopenharmony_ci	u16 mode;
1668c2ecf20Sopenharmony_ci	struct spear_pmx_mode **pmx_modes;
1678c2ecf20Sopenharmony_ci	unsigned npmx_modes;
1688c2ecf20Sopenharmony_ci};
1698c2ecf20Sopenharmony_ci
1708c2ecf20Sopenharmony_ci/**
1718c2ecf20Sopenharmony_ci * struct spear_pmx - SPEAr pinctrl mux
1728c2ecf20Sopenharmony_ci * @dev: pointer to struct dev of platform_device registered
1738c2ecf20Sopenharmony_ci * @pctl: pointer to struct pinctrl_dev
1748c2ecf20Sopenharmony_ci * @machdata: pointer to SoC or machine specific structure
1758c2ecf20Sopenharmony_ci * @vbase: virtual base address of pinmux controller
1768c2ecf20Sopenharmony_ci */
1778c2ecf20Sopenharmony_cistruct spear_pmx {
1788c2ecf20Sopenharmony_ci	struct device *dev;
1798c2ecf20Sopenharmony_ci	struct pinctrl_dev *pctl;
1808c2ecf20Sopenharmony_ci	struct spear_pinctrl_machdata *machdata;
1818c2ecf20Sopenharmony_ci	void __iomem *vbase;
1828c2ecf20Sopenharmony_ci};
1838c2ecf20Sopenharmony_ci
1848c2ecf20Sopenharmony_ci/* exported routines */
1858c2ecf20Sopenharmony_cistatic inline u32 pmx_readl(struct spear_pmx *pmx, u32 reg)
1868c2ecf20Sopenharmony_ci{
1878c2ecf20Sopenharmony_ci	return readl_relaxed(pmx->vbase + reg);
1888c2ecf20Sopenharmony_ci}
1898c2ecf20Sopenharmony_ci
1908c2ecf20Sopenharmony_cistatic inline void pmx_writel(struct spear_pmx *pmx, u32 val, u32 reg)
1918c2ecf20Sopenharmony_ci{
1928c2ecf20Sopenharmony_ci	writel_relaxed(val, pmx->vbase + reg);
1938c2ecf20Sopenharmony_ci}
1948c2ecf20Sopenharmony_ci
1958c2ecf20Sopenharmony_civoid pmx_init_addr(struct spear_pinctrl_machdata *machdata, u16 reg);
1968c2ecf20Sopenharmony_civoid pmx_init_gpio_pingroup_addr(struct spear_gpio_pingroup *gpio_pingroup,
1978c2ecf20Sopenharmony_ci				 unsigned count, u16 reg);
1988c2ecf20Sopenharmony_ciint spear_pinctrl_probe(struct platform_device *pdev,
1998c2ecf20Sopenharmony_ci			struct spear_pinctrl_machdata *machdata);
2008c2ecf20Sopenharmony_ci
